What is medical oxygen ?

Medical oxygen is the most widely used medical gas in hospitals. It is mainly used clinically for the treatment of shock caused by drowning, nitrite, cocaine, carbon monoxide and respiratory muscle paralysis. It is also used for the prevention and treatment of pneumonia, myocarditis and heart dysfunction. On the other hand, due to the large-scale spread of COVID-19, the importance of medical oxygen in treatment has gradually become prominent, directly affecting the cure rate and survival status of patients.

Medical oxygen was not initially strictly distinguished from industrial oxygen, and both were obtained by separating air. Before 1988, hospitals at all levels in my country used industrial oxygen. It was not until 1988 that the “Medical Oxygen” standard was introduced and made mandatory, abolishing the clinical use of industrial oxygen. Compared with industrial oxygen, the standards for medical oxygen are more stringent. Medical oxygen needs to filter out other gas impurities(such as car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ide, ozone and acid-base compounds) to prevent poisoning and other hazards during use. In addition to purity requirements, medical oxygen has higher requirements on the volume and cleanliness of storage bottles, making it more suitable for use in hospitals.

Medical oxygen classification and market size

From the source, it includes cylinder oxygen prepared by oxygen plants and oxygen obtained by oxygen concentrators in hospitals; In terms of oxygen state, there are two categories: liquid oxygen and gaseous oxygen; It is also worth noting that in addition to 99.5% high-purity oxygen, there is also a type of oxygen-enriched air with an oxygen content of 93%. In 2013, the State Food and Drug Administration issued the national drug standard for oxygen-enriched air(93% oxygen), using “oxygen-enriched air” as the generic name for the drug, strengthening management and supervision, and it is currently widely used in hospitals.

The production of oxygen by hospitals through oxygen production equipment has relatively higher requirement on hospital scale and equipment technology, and the advantages are also more obvious. In 2016, the Meical Gases and Engineering Branch of the China Industrial Gases Association, in collaboration with the Standards Division of the Medical Management Center of National Health and Family Planning Commission, surveyed 200 hospitals across the country. The results showed that 49% of hospitals used liquid oxygen, 27% used molecular sieve oxygen generators, and some hospitals with low oxygen consumption used oxygen cylinders to supply oxygen. However, in recent years, the disadvantages of using liquid oxygen and bottled oxygen have become increasingly prominent. 85% of newly built hospitals prefer to choose modern molecular sieve oxygen production equipment, and most old hospitals choose to use oxygen machines instead of traditional bottled oxygen.

Hospital oxygen equipment and quality control

Traditional cylinder oxygen and liquid oxygen in hospitals are produced by cryogenic air separation. Gaseous cylinder oxygen can be used directly, while liquid oxygen needs to be stored replaced, decompressed, and vaporized before it can be put into clinical use.

There are many problems in the use of oxygen cylinders, including difficulty in storage and transportation, inconvenience in use, etc. The biggest problem is safety. Steel cylinders are high-pressure containers that are prone to serious accidents. Due to major safety hazards, the use of cylinders needs to be phased out in large hospitals and hospitals with large flow of patients. In addition to the problems with the cylinders themselves, many companies without medical oxygen qualifications produce and sell cylinder oxygen, which contains inferior products and too many impurities. There are even cases where industrial oxygen is disguised as medical oxygen, and hospitals find it difficult to distinguish the quality when purchasing, which may lead to very serious medical accidents.

With the advancement of technology, many hospitals have begun to choose oxygen concentrator. The main oxygen production methods currently used are molecular sieve oxygen production systems and membrane separation oxygen production systems, which are widely used in hospitals.

The main thing to mention here is the molecular sieve oxygen concentrator. It uses pressure swing adsorption technology to directly enrich oxygen from the air. It is safe and convenient to use. Its convenience was especially fully demonstrated during the qpidemic, helping medical staff to free their hands. The autonomous oxygen production and supply completely eliminated the time of carrying oxygen cylinders, and increased hospitals’ willingness to purchase molecular sieve oxygen generators.

Currently, most of the oxygen produced is oxygen-enriched air(93% oxygen), which can meet the oxygen needs of general wards or small medical institutions that do not perform critical surgery, but cannot meet the oxygen needs of large-scale, ICUs, and oxygen chambers.

Application and prospect of Medical Oxygen

The epidemic has increasingly highlighted the importance of meical oxygen in clinical practice, but the shortage of medical oxygen supply has also beed found in some countries.

At the same time, large and medium-sized hospitals are gradually phasing out cylinders to improve safety, so the upgrading and transformation of oxygen production enterprises is also imperative. With the popularization of oxygen production technology, hospital oxygen gengerators are more widely used. How to further improve intelligence, reduce costs, and make them more integrated and portable while ensuring the quality of oxygen production has also become a development direction for oxygen generators.

Meical oxygen plays a very important auxiliary role in the treatment of various diseases, and how to improve quality control and optimize the supply system has become a problem that companies and hospitals need to face together.
